Transaction 30c869a144d659682324f5542a0a69925bccd013b099affe9aa6d0689ed7b944
1 Input
1 Output
-
30c869a144d659682324f5542a0a69925bccd013b099affe9aa6d0689ed7b944:0
- value
- 17331462
- script pubkey
- OP_0 OP_PUSHBYTES_20 caca6c0709a89d1569815f39c1fddb2c5157e1e4
- address
- bc1qet9xcpcf4zw326vptuuurlwm93g40c0y5ngdlh